Peter Bosz has admitted that Liverpool have not approached him despite his PSV Eindhoven side being nine points ahead of Arne Slot’s Feyenoord.
Liverpool are in talks with Feyenoord as they push to take Slot to Anfield as the successor to their current manager Jurgen Klopp.
The Dutch club have already rejected a €9m offer from Liverpool and want somewhere around €15m in compensation from the Merseyside giants.
Slot’s Feyenoord won the Eredivisie last season but are nine points behind Bosz’s PSV side...
